Raising Royalty: Setting Up for Miniature Highland Calves
Preparing to get ready for raising miniature highland calves is a pleasurable journey that requires careful preparation. These delightful calves are known for their calm temperament and unique appearance.
A well-structured shelter is essential to ensure their well-being. The area should be adequately sized to allow for free movement. Offering clean, fresh water and a balanced feed is crucial for their development.
To create a healthy environment, consider incorporating different combinations of bedding materials such as straw, wood shavings, or hay. This will assist in preserving warmth Tips for raising healthy calves at home and collecting moisture. Regular cleaning is also essential to avoid the spread of diseases.
Furthermore, ensure entry to a shaded area to protect them from intense heat or cold.
A Perfect Mini Highland Calf Home Setup
Welcoming a mini Highland calf into your life is a truly delightful experience. To ensure their well-being, it's crucial to create a cozy home setup that caters to their unique needs. Firstly, you'll want to build a sturdy shelter that provides protection from the weather. A well-insulated outbuilding is ideal, with plenty of space for them to move.
- Make sure a comfortable bedding area using bedding material, and always maintain it fresh for optimal comfort.
- Offer access to fresh, clean water at all times. A automatic water source is particularly important in wintery climates.
- Boost their diet with a nutritious mix of forage, and consider offering with grain for extra growth.
Always bear in mind that mini Highland calves are gregarious, so ensuring companionship with additional calves or a peaceful adult is highly positive. With a some effort and care, you can create the perfect setting for your mini Highland calf to grow!
